Palm Desert vs Glendora
Side-by-side comparison
How does Palm Desert, CA compare to Glendora, CA? Palm Desert has a population of 51,551 with a median household income of $79,508, while Glendora has 51,350 residents and a median income of $111,915.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Palm Desert, CA | Glendora, CA |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 51,551 | 51,350 | +0.4% |
| Median Age | 56.7 | 40.5 | +40.0% |
| Foreign Born % | 17.4% | 19% | -8.4% |
| Metric | Palm Desert | Glendora |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$79,508 | $111,915 | -29.0% |
| Unemployment | 6.1% | 6.1% | 0.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 11.3% | 7.4% | +52.7% |
| Bachelor's+ | 39.9% | 39.3% | +1.5% |
| Metric | Palm Desert | Glendora |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$491,600 | $820,800 | -40.1% |
| Median Rent | $1717/mo | $2218/mo | -22.6% |
| Housing Units | 36,584 | 17,254 | +112.0% |
